About the role:

We are looking for a motivated and commercially minded Junior Property Lawyer (Newly Qualified Solicitor to 1 year PQE) to join our in-house legal team.

Working closely with the Senior Legal Counsel, you will support the management of a diverse property portfolio spanning retail, investment and development. This is an excellent opportunity to gain broad in-house experience across a wide range of commercial property matters, including portfolio management, landlord and tenant issues, acquisitions, disposals and development projects.

Key Responsibilities

  • Drafting, reviewing and negotiating leases, licences and related property documentation.
  • Advising on landlord and tenant matters across the portfolio.
  • Advising on retail leases for well-known restaurant brands.
  • Assisting with acquisitions, disposals and property investment transactions.
  • Supporting development projects, including option agreements, easements, wayleaves and solar leases.
  • Undertaking property due diligence and managing post-completion matters, including Land Registry applications and SDLT filings.
  • Liaising with external advisers and supporting legal risk management across the portfolio.

About You

  • Newly Qualified Solicitor or up to 1 year PQE.
  • Experience or a strong interest in commercial property law.
  • Commercially aware, organised and detail-oriented.
  • Strong communication and stakeholder management skills.
